Discover Your Wings, designed by Nancy McKinney, is the next set to be part of the TE Giving Tree Program - every three months Taylored Expressions designs a new stamp set to support a charity for 3 months after the release. I love taking the opportunity to help different charities through the purchase of a stamp set - it is helping others while supporting a hobby I love. For this release, $7 will be donated to Now I Lay Me Down To Sleep for every Discover Your Wings set purchased. The Now I Lay Me Down to Sleep Foundation is a charity that administers a network of almost 7000 photographers in the US and 25 other countries who volunteer their time to gently provide a helping hand and healing heart to families who have suffered the loss of an infant by offering gentle and beautiful photography services in a compassionate and sensitive manner. NILMDTS is there for parents and families to help them in their healing, bring hope to their future, and to honor their child. They believe that it is through remembrance that a family can truly begin to heal. Taylored Expressions is honored to help support the work of this wonderful charity. I started by stamping the flower silhouettes in Rich Razzleberry and sponged the edges with Crushed Curry ink. The butterfly is stamped in Melon Mambo and popped up on a dimensional. I used MOJO115 for the sketch.

recipe -
Stamps: Discover Your Wings (Taylored Expressions)
Paper: Rich Razzleberry, Crushed Curry, Very Vanilla card stock, Razzleberry Lemonade paper (SU!)
Ink: Rich Razzleberry, Crushed Curry (SU!)
Accessories: Wine rhinestones (Kaisercraft), Taylor's Tiny Twinkles (TE), oval/scallop & circle/scallop Nestabilities (Spellbinders), stampin' dimensionals (SU!)
